Abstract
A device may include a coil unit assembly that includes a first, second, and third coil unit annularly arranged. Further, may include a busbar provided on an outer peripheral surface of the coil unit assembly, wherein when a direction in which an axis of the stator extends is defined as an axial direction, a direction which is orthogonal to the axial direction and in which outer peripheral surface and inner peripheral surface of the stator face each other is a radial direction, and a direction along an outer periphery of the stator when viewed from the axial direction is a circumferential direction, wherein the coil units each include a split core that includes a tooth that extends in the radial direction, an insulator mounted to overlap at least the tooth of the split core, and a coil that includes a winding wound around the tooth of the split core with the insulator interposed therebetween.
